Zetor Tractors made a net profit of CZK 115 mil with revenues of CZK 2,924 mil in 2017, up by 36.3% and down by 8.25%, respectively, compared to the previous year. This translates into a net margin of 3.94%.
Historically, between 2006 - 2017, the firm’s net profit reached a high of CZK 284 mil in 2013 and a low of CZK -298 mil in 2008. Since 2012, the firm's net profit has decreased 58.7% or -16.2% a year on average.
On the operating level, EBITDA reached CZK 128 mil, down 45.4% compared to the previous year. Over the last five years, company's EBITDA has fallen 23.6% a year on average.
As far as Zetor Tractors's peers are concerned, Tatra Trucks posted net and EBITDA margin of 8.91% and 11.7%, respectively in 2017, Iveco Czech Republic generated margins of 10.1% and 13.3% and Skoda Auto profit margin reached 7.82% on the net and 15.4% on the EBITDA level in 2019.
